Joomla 1.5.8
I have been spending a lot of time recently playing with Joomla v1.5.x. It took me a little while to wrap my head around how to create a website using it as I come from a background of coding webpages by hand. I have discovered that using a Content Management System (CMS) like Joomla makes the whole process so much easier. Once you wrap your head around the concept of sections, categories, modules, articles, etc. I discovered that it was quite easy to get a website up and running. Of course the hard part is finding the right template or coding / editing one to get the look and functionally you want. Once this part is done you just need to organize your content into sections then in to categories (sub-section). Then you just have to write your content into articles and publish them. Of course you will need to create menus to make your content accessible as well. Then add these menus to a module to get them appear. There are tons of other things you can do as well with add on extensions that can add everything from a full shopping cart to a simple hits counter and everything in between.
So far Joomla v1.5 is a great CMS and I will most likely be using it for all my website in the future. Unless they are a blog in which case I will continue to use WordPress as I am doing with this site.
